Paithani Training And Development Centre Opens in Chhatrapati Sambhajinagar
A new centre for learning how to make Paithani sarees opened at a college in Chhatrapati Sambhajinagar.
Abdul Sattar inaugurated it on Saturday.
The event was organised by the Shiv Sena and Vaijapur Taluka Vikas Manch.
Industrialist Dr J.K. Jadhav helped start the centre.
He said the centres are meant to give women employment opportunities.
Other activities included computer training, health awareness and awards for teachers and students.
Paithani weavers were also honoured.
Jadhav said he wants to open more centres across Marathwada.
